Empathy and the Phantasmic in Ethnic American Trauma Narratives examines a burgeoning genre of ethnic American literature and film called phantasmic trauma narratives, which use culturally specific modes of the supernatural to connect readers to historical traumas in ways that encourage empathic responses.

This book conveniently surveys the lives and works of African American women writers.

Included are alphabetically arranged entries on more than 150 African American women novelists, poets, playwrights, short fiction writers, autobiographers, essayists, and influential scholars.

John Kerry tells the story of his extraordinary life of public service, from decorated Vietnam veteran to five-term United Statessenator, 2004 Democratic presidential candidate, and Secretary of State for four years: a personal and candid memoir by awitness to some of the most important events of our recent history, including the Iran nuclear deal and the Paris climateaccords.
